How to Make a Juju Hat
- You can use a variety of material for this project. It can be done with feathers, yarn or raffia.
- Trace a circle out of a poster board and cut it out.
- Cut a hole in the center.
- Cut from the outside to the inner circle.
- Cut your raffia about inch longer than your poster board circle.
- Spread the raffia on top of the circle and spread it out like a fan.
- Divide the sides of the raffia bundle, to create an X shape.
- Turn your project over and pull the ends of the raffia through the inner circle and tie a knot.
- Use popsicle sticks to help secure your knot.
